Make Commit If Successful optional when running proof build using shelved changelist

 Description  « Hide
Could you please add a mechanism for selecting/deselecting "commit if successful" when running a proof build using a shelved changelist. For example developer A runs a proof build using a shelved change list and wants to commit the changes on successful build while developer B runs a proof build using a shelved change list but does not want to commit the changes on successful build
